Quick Summary
The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) is conducting market research through a Request for Information (RFI) and Sources Sought to identify qualified firms for Guldmann OR EQUAL Patient Transfer Equipment at the VA San Diego Healthcare System. The VA is specifically seeking Small Businesses,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Businesses (SDVOSB), and Veteran-Owned Small Businesses (VOSB). Responses are due by June 19, 2026, at 11:59 PM Pacific Time (PT).
Purpose
This RFI is for market research and planning purposes only, not a solicitation. Its goal is to inform acquisition decisions and identify capable small businesses interested in providing patient transfer equipment. Domestic or suitable domestic alternative sources are sought.
Scope of Work
The requirement involves providing and installing Guldmann GH3+ OR EQUAL 600 lbs ceiling patient lift systems. This includes hoists, rails, charging liners, stabilizers, endstops, trainer modules, integrated scales, CLM with Wi-Fi, assessment, drawings, service, and clinical training. The contractor must also supply all necessary above-grid hardware, 4 slings per system, and perform installation (including in asbestos conditions) and removal of existing patient lift systems. Products must meet regulatory expectations (e.g., FDA Class I) and be new equipment from an OEM, authorized dealer, distributor, or reseller.

Submission Requirements
Interested contractors must respond via email to Dyne.Kim@va.gov with:
- Company details (name, address, point of contact, phone, email)
- Unique Entity ID (SAM) number
- Type of small business (if applicable)
- Statement on small business status under NAICS 339113 (or alternative NAICS)
- Brand, model, and product description of the patient lift intended for provision, including country of origin and manufacturer's small business status
- Statement on authorized distributor status (with manufacturer approval letter if applicable)
- Information on existing federal contracts (GSA FSS, VA NAC, NASA SEWP, etc.)
- Estimated delivery time (ARO)
- General pricing for items 0001-0005 (Guldmann GH3+ OR EQUAL systems, hardware, slings, installation, removal)
- Self-attestation/certification of regulatory compliance (e.g., FDA Class I)
- A detailed capability statement with at least one reference contract demonstrating experience, including contract number, description of tasks, dates, and verifiable contact information.
